Output e6850f5c23a2924e6830cd34977fe6571f981b38a46ad7b8e10672acb2fe2168:0

value
4960586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32bcf7afe39a1cfd703036aa12f52615b2614411 OP_EQUALVERIFY OP_CHECKSIG
address
15dHAHZUyQoJU1vzbhKSnWSJvBLxBZsdYW
transaction
e6850f5c23a2924e6830cd34977fe6571f981b38a46ad7b8e10672acb2fe2168
spent
true